Exhibit 99.2 provides a statement on the uses and usefulness of non-GAAP (Generally Accepted Accounting Principles) information. This is important for investors as it helps them understand how Entergy uses and interprets financial metrics that may differ from standard accounting practices.

The information in this 8-K filing, specifically under Item 2.02, is being furnished, not filed. This means it is not subject to the liabilities of Section 18 of the Securities Exchange Act of 1934, although it is still important for investors to review.
